Several drier mnufaeturefts' are now marketteg a am type of drier. Chemically they are the mineral spirits solution of the metallic soaps - derived from ethyl hexo.le acid.
Two. sour.oes. of .this net drier have been evaluated to determine hot? they compare with our standard lead, cobalt and manga- . nee n&phthenat /drier, Th sources' evaluated ver Advance Sol-.,
vents and Chemical Corp. Hexogen driers and Fred.A. Btresen-Beuter, Inc.'s Octoat.e driers. Also tee laded in this' study were Ferro
Chemical Company-'e .naphthenate driers which they claim are superior to other naphthonat driers on the market for color and ease of disper.ion .because of their lower viscosity.

Bee nits were as followt
Prying Fropertie.
Hon of the drier tested showed any advantage over our
present source of naphthmate driers' either initially or after five months storage. In both 153-005 and BS-265 our naphthnate drier showed slightly better initial dry and noticeably better dry after five months.
Color.
Only slight difference* ter noted in the .00lor of the. clears with the advantage in favor of the naphtben&t .drier, fhi
slight difference was net noticeable in the film, fhe Ferro drier were lightly superior to our n&phthen&tes.
Odor .The dor of the Hexogen sad Octoat drlei'* as received
is better than Ida n&phthenates, Also the odor of the enssala in tli can using the new type drier is less objectionable, However, when the bottoms of gallon can were painted and. .allowed to dry with the lids on and sniff tests made at various drying stages, the better odor was not as apparent. Results of the sniff tests show ed that the preference of individual mu divided about equally for odor between the naphthenates and the new type.
In view of the above results, it does not appear that the Hexogen and Octoat driers are superior in any respect to our pre sent drier with the possible exception of odor in the package. Even if there was no question regarding the better odor of the new type drier, the deficient drying properties noted above would not warrant a general shift to them. The superior color claimed for. the Ferro' driers was not noticed in this study.
